I went through Qlik's entire hiring process, which included four interviews, an informal case study, and five reference checks. However, I've been waiting over five weeks for a final decision, despite them initially aiming for a mid-February hire. Communication was spotty throughout, and the hiring team seemed disorganized. Interviewers weren't clear about where I was in the process, and there wasn't a clear evaluation structure. The hiring manager seemed friendly but overwhelmed and unsure of what she needed. In one interview, I had to lead the conversation because relevant questions weren't asked about my background. I also completed an unofficial exercise, and my references were contacted without any clear outcome. It feels like a waste of time for everyone involved.

I was contacted via LinkedIn for a Customer Success/Experience role. The process began with a recruiter call to discuss the hiring manager's needs and learn more about my background. This initial chat was informative and increased my interest. The recruiter then set up a call with the hiring manager, which was helpful for getting technical and specific questions answered. Following that, the hiring manager outlined the remaining steps: interviews with team members at various levels and a take-home assignment involving a use case. I had to prepare a presentation based on this use case to present to a team, including the hiring manager's manager. I was given about a week to work on the presentation, which was quite demanding but allowed me to showcase my skills. The entire interview process moved swiftly as they aimed to make a decision before the year's end.
